Tossup

So-called “designer solvents” named for this term are functionalized to make them task-specific. In the Debye–Hückel limiting law, the natural logarithm of the mean activity coefficient is proportional to the square root of a quantity named for this term. The quantity (10[1])“square root of 12 over 12 minus coordination number, all minus one” defines the critical value of the ratio in compounds described by this term written as “r-sub-C over r-sub-A.” This term names room-temperature liquids such as BMIM-PF6 and EMIM. (10[1])Compounds described by this term are described by Pauling’s five rules. The Born–Haber cycle calculates the lattice energy of compounds (-5[1])described by this term. (10[1])For 10 points, name this term that describes bonds between two oppositely (10[1])charged (10[1])species (10[2])such as sodium and chloride. (10[1])■END■ (10[1])

ANSWER: ionic [accept ionic liquids or ionic strength or ionic radius or ionic bonds]
